BIGTRUCK Posted September 25, 2019 Posted September 25, 2019 (edited) Flinstone resin build completed this week. Its listed as a 1940 Cord custom but it resembles a Delahaye . I did use a Lindberg Cord as a donor kit. Extended the chassis 1:5 inches ( body is over 8" long )and used most of the kit interior. Had to modify the kit engine so the hood fit and still had to cut a hole in it and add the scoop. Cut the front glass from some clear plastic and rear glass from green/clear plastic. Removed the resin cast grille and fit in a plastic chrome one. Headlights, rear lights, exhaust, grille, battery, side vents and horn are parts box items. Edited September 25, 2019 by BIGTRUCK
